你查询的IP:[122.51.85.209]  地理位置:中国–上海–上海

最新查询119.80.189.99 211.64.44.211 124.224.66.28 121.60.192.183 122.64.30.239 210.25.19.196 117.121.188.177 203.93.68.136 125.112.49.73 122.51.85.209 124.172.109.184 116.242.227.41 119.112.151.100 116.70.103.218 121.204.90.32 219.242.182.19 203.175.192.84 202.8.128.50 116.58.208.208 61.232.108.125 124.160.95.203 125.208.223.0 119.84.193.99 202.127.128.102 203.148.228.255 218.74.47.239 123.253.2.135 117.72.100.83 116.213.128.18 60.194.7.60 198.17.7.240